Food
Arrangement inside the
refrigerator
Fresh fish and meat Above the fruit and vegetable bins
Fresh cheese Above the fruit and vegetable bins
Cooked food On any shelf
Salami, loaves of bread,
chocolate
On any shelf
Fruit and vegetables
In the fruit and vegetable
compartment bins
Eggs On the shelf provided
Butter and margarine On the shelf provided
Bottles, drinks, milk On the shelves provided
Place only cold or lukewarm foods in the compartment, not hot
foods (
see Precautions and tips
).
Remember that cooked foods do not last longer than raw foods.
Do not store liquids in open containers. They will increase
humidity in the refrigerator and cause condensation to form.
SHELVES: with or without grill.
Due to the special guides the shelves are removable and the
height is adjustable (
see diagram
), allowing easy storage of large
containers and food. Height can be adjusted without complete
removal of the shelf.
Maintenance and care
Switching the appliance off
During cleaning and maintenance it is necessary to disconnect the
appliance from the electricity supply.
It is not sufficient to set the temperature adjustment knobs on OFF
(appliance off) to eliminate all electrical contact.
Cleaning the appliance
The external and internal parts, as well as the rubber seals may
be cleaned using a sponge that has been soaked in lukewarm
water and bicarbonate of soda or neutral soap. Do not use
solvents, abrasive products, bleach or ammonia.
The removable accessories may be soaked in warm water and
soap or dishwashing liquid. Rinse and dry them carefully.
The back of the appliance may collect dust which can be
removed by delicately using the hose of a vacuum cleaner set
on medium power. The appliance must be switched off and the
plug must be pulled out before cleaning the appliance.
Avoiding mould and unpleasant odours
The appliance is manufactured with hygienic materials which are
odour free. In order to maintain an odour free refrigerator and to
prevent the formation of stains, food must always be covered or
sealed properly.
If you want to switch the appliance off for an extended period of
time, clean the inside and leave the doors open.
Defrosting the appliance
! Follow the instructions below.
Do not speed up the defrosting process by using any devices or
tools other than the scraper provided, you may damage the
refrigeration circuit.
The refrigerator has an automatic defrosting function: water is
ducted to the back of the appliance by a special discharge outlet
(
see diagram
) where the heat produced by the compressor
causes it to evaporate. It is necessary to clean the discharge hole
regularly so that the water can flow out easily.
Replacing the light bulb
To replace the light bulb in the refrigerator compartment, pull out
the plug from the electrical socket. Follow the instructions below.
Access the light bulb by removing the cover as indicated in the
diagram. Replace it with a similar light bulb within the power range
indicated on the cover (15W or 25W).
